题解 | #实现接口#
实现接口
http://www.nowcoder.com/practice/b47b04275f7e4fa588221f03b2527d4d
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Comparator comparator = new ComparatorImpl();
Scanner scanner = new Scanner(System.in);
while (scanner.hasNextInt()) {
int x = scanner.nextInt();
int y = scanner.nextInt();
System.out.println(comparator.max(x, y));
}
}
}
interface Comparator {
/**
* 返回两个整数中的最大值
*/
int max(int x, int y);
}
//write your code here......
class ComparatorImpl implements Comparator{//继承接口用implements,而继承类则用extends
public int max(int x,int y){
return x>y?x:y;
}
}